The Stables Cafe @ Orleans House Gallery
Orleans House Cafe
Riverside
Twickenham
London
TW1 3DJ
Riverside
Twickenham
London
TW1 3DJ
Please mention you found
us on The Good Dog Guide
- Dog's welcome inside the cafe
- Doggie treats available!

...
This is all the information we currently hold for this business.
If you listed this business please see our advertise page for details on how to enhance your listing.